Sunil Khilnani

Sunil Khilnani is a professor of politics and the director of the India Institute at King's College London. Born in New Delhi, he grew up in India, Africa and Europe. He was educated at Trinity Hall, Cambridge, where he took a first in social and political sciences, and at King’s College, Cambridge, where he gained his PhD in Social and Political Sciences. Khilnani’s research interests lie at the intersection of various fields: intellectual history and the study of political thought, the history of modern India, democratic theory in relation to its recent non-Western experiences, the politics of contemporary India, and strategic thought in the definition of India’s place in the world. His most recent book is Incarnations: India in 50 Lives (2016), which accompanies his 50-part podcast and radio series broadcast on BBC Radio 4 in 2015-16 — the book is available in paperback from September 2017. The 20th anniversary edition of The Idea of India will be available in November 2017.
